It’s all about knowing the subtleties of the 2023 optics market trends and making an informed choice. There are two main patterns that we can see on the market right now. One is that we have a wave of variable low power optics (LPVOs) with magnifications like 1-8 or 1-10x, perfect for ARs and short-range carbines. In contrast, there is an influx of hunting scopes, with magnifications ranging from 3-to-12 or 4-to-16 power constructed on 30-mm or 1-inch tubes. Choice of Reticle: First or Second Focal Plane

Imagine the reticle as the center of the scope. It’s that crosshair, or aiming point you notice when you examine your scope. Reticles are now available in two forms: first focal plane (FFP) and second one called focal plane (SFP). Without getting too technical, FFP reticles change size depending on the magnification you set and SFP Reticles are identical in size, regardless of the magnification. Which is the most suitable range scope to use with your rifle? It all depends on your shooting style. If you’re an experienced long range shooter who requires quick adjustments An FFP may be your best bet. However when your shots tend to be in a constant distance, an SFP will perform just fine. Technical Terms and Scope Basics

The world of rifle scopes can feel like learning a new language. There are numerous technical terms to understand But don’t worry, we’ve got you covered. Let’s take a look at some of the terminology and basic concepts of scopes to give you a head start on finding the perfect rifle scope to meet your requirements.

Explanation of Key Technical Terms

Let’s start by decoding some of the most common technical terms that you’ll encounter when shopping for an optic for your rifle.

Reticle

A reticle, often known as crosshairs is the image you will see when you view at the camera. It assists you in aiming at your target. Reticles are available in a variety of designs, ranging from simple crosshairs to more complex designs with features to help you estimate windage, range, and the drop of a bullet.

Eye Relief

Ever been hit in the eye by your own scope? Most likely, you did not have enough eye relief. The term “eye relief” is the distance between you eye and the optic, which lets you still see the entire image. More eye relief means you’ll have a a safer shooting experience in particular with high-recoil guns.

Eye Box

Eye box refers to the area behind the scope, where you can still see the entire field of vision. A larger eye box provides greater flexibility for head positioning, making the scope more comfortable to use.

Parallax

Do you recognize that illusion when you’re in a car and nearby objects seem to be moving faster than distant ones? That’s parallax. In scopes, errors caused by parallax are caused when the target image and the reticle do not lie within the same plane of optical reflection. High-quality scopes often include the ability to adjust parallax. Top Brands Of Rifle Scopes Rated.

Windage

Windage refers to the horizontal adjustment on your scope. It accounts for wind direction and speed as well as the movement of a bullet’s horizontal because of other variables.

Elevation

Elevation however, is the vertical adjustment on your scope. It allows you to aim either higher or lower to account for bullet drop when you travel a distance.

Explanation of First and Second Focal Plane

We briefly touched on this in the past but let’s dig into it a bit more. In a first focus plane (FFP) scope the size of the reticle changes according to the magnification. That means the holdovers of windage, elevation, and range remain constant regardless of the magnification. On the flip side when you use a second focus plane (SFP) scope, the reticle size stays the same regardless of the magnification. This means the holdovers can only be accurate at a single magnification level usually the highest.

Process of Zeroing a Scope

Adjusting a scope to zero means changing it so that the reticle’s point of view is the point of impact an exact distance. In simple terms it’s about making sure that the bullet lands exactly the reticle’s target. This involves carefully-planned adjustments to your windage and elevation depending on the feedback from your shot It’s essential for accurate shooting.

Explanation of Magnification

The magnification of a scope informs the user how close to your target appears when compared in the eyes of a naked. A 4x magnification, for example, means that the target appears four times closer. Scopes can have either variable or fixed magnification.

Importance of Objective Lens Size

It is the lens in side of your scope. The size of the lens determines how much light can enter the scope, affecting brightness and clarity. A bigger objective lens lets more light to enter which improves visibility even in low light conditions. However, it makes the scope bigger and heavier.
